Hello Bill:

Good to hear someone else knows of Ellwood Epps. I've got a soft spot of them since my brother and I used to visit their shop in Windsor, Ont, from our childhood home in Detroit in the late '50s. Lots of good surplus and guns we didn't usually see in the States.

We still do business with them, but they moved up near Orillia some time ago. Not too many "303 Epps Improved" but a good mix of the modern (338 Lapua) and historic (40-110).
